The warlock of firetop mountain is a singleplayer roleplaying gamebook written by steve jackson and ian livingstone, illustrated by russ nicholson and originally published in 1982 by puffin books. Island of the lizard king is a singleplayer roleplaying gamebook written by ian livingstone, illustrated by alan langford and originally published in 1984 by puffin books.
